The Ledger invoice template

Centred, serif and formal. The template for invoices that will be filed rather than glanced at.

Ledger centres your name at the top of the page under an optional logo, sets the word INVOICE in wide-tracked capitals, and rules the whole thing off with a single line. It reads like a letterhead, because that is what institutions are used to receiving.

The total is not filled. It sits under a rule, weighted rather than coloured. On a document that ends up in a compliance folder or attached to a purchase order, that restraint is the correct choice.
